Options for Multi-Day Trips
- Fogo Island Adventure: A 3-4 day journey to Fogo Island, known for its stunning coastline, picturesque fishing villages, and world-class hiking trails. Enjoy traditional Newfoundland cuisine, interact with the local community, and take part in activities like whale watching and ice caving (seasonal).
- Gros Morne National Park Explorer: A 3-4 day trip to Gros Morne, a UNESCO World Heritage Site featuring breathtaking landscapes, unique geological formations, and diverse wildlife. Hike the famous Tablelands, explore the coastline, and experience the rich cultural heritage of this unique region.
- Iceberg Alley Adventure: A 2-3 day journey to explore the stunning coastline and witness the majestic icebergs that drift down from the Arctic. Visit picturesque fishing villages, enjoy local cuisine, and take part in activities like kayaking or hiking.
Tips for Multi-Day Trips
- Weather Conditions: Be prepared for unpredictable weather in Newfoundland’s coastal regions. Bring layers, waterproof gear, and be flexible with your itinerary.
- Transportation: Most multi-day trips involve driving or using public transportation to reach the destination. Consider renting a car or booking guided tours that include transportation.
- Accommodations: Choose accommodations that suit your budget and preferences, ranging from cozy B&Bs to luxury lodges. Be sure to book in advance, especially during peak season.
- Respect Local Communities: Remember to respect the local culture and communities you visit. Engage with the people, learn about their traditions, and follow any guidelines or regulations provided by your guide or tour operator.
